The Foreign Investors Association of Albania (FIAA) marked the 25th anniversary of its founding with an exclusive Gala Event, a festive occasion that brought together leaders of nearly 100 member companies, foreign ambassadors accredited in Albania, senior representatives of the Albanian government, heads of business organizations, and many long-time friends of the Association.
The evening opened with warm greetings from Mr. Balazs Revesz, President of FIAA, who emphasized that while celebrating the Association’s history, the milestone also reflected Albania’s remarkable progress. Ms. Marinela Jazoj, FIAA’s Director, added a personal touch by sharing cherished memories from FIAA’s long and transformative journey.
H.E. Silvio Gonzato, Ambassador of the European Union to Albania, conveyed his heartfelt greetings to the audience, expressing his appreciation for FIAA’s valued partnership with the European Union, noting its important role as a partner and sounding board on foreign investment and business climate reforms.
A special highlight of the jubilee was the presence of FIAA’s Honorary President, Mr. Kent R. Ford, one of the Association’s founding members in 2000. He reflected on FIAA’s early beginnings, its initial challenges, and its continuing role in shaping Albania’s investment landscape.
The event was further enriched by the participation of several former FIAA Presidents—Patrick PASCAL, Constantin von Alvensleben, and Silvio Pedrazzi—each of whom delivered thoughtful remarks on the Association’s challenges and accomplishments over the years. Additional tributes were shared by Mr. Mario Tonucci, representing one of the first foreign companies in Albania, and Ms. Rafaela Rica, a steadfast supporter and one of FIAA’s earliest members.
This landmark celebration was not only a tribute to FIAA’s 25 years of dedication to improving Albania’s business environment but also a reaffirmation of its commitment to the future.
